The charging documents, which were reviewed by MS NOW, show that the sailor has been accused of violating Article 83 for “malingering,” which is defined as a service member “intentionally faking an illness or hurting themselves to avoid work, duty or service,” and Article 86 for “absence without leave,” which means a service member failed to be at their required place of duty without proper authority.
